Harmating Castle

Highlight • Castle

Tower castle from the 13th century, today owned by the writer Albert von Schirnding

St. Leonhard Chapel

Highlight • Religious Site

The chapel on Harmatinger Höhe was built in 1680/85 on behalf of the castle owners at the time, the von Barth patrician family from Munich. The octagonal central building with …
